Restaurant Summary
A small counter shop near the hospital turning out big, foldable slices with that crisp-chewy New York snap. Most folks rave about the balance of cheese and sauce and the fast turnaround. One diner put it simply: "The crust folds perfectly and the slice eats like a meal." Expect a compact room and a quick in-and-out rhythm over lingering meals. The cooking sticks to classic American-Italian comfort: cheese and pepperoni slices, buffalo chicken, subs, burgers, and a few pastas. When it is on, the pizza hits that craveable zone; on off nights, toppings can run pale or dry and orders may get fumbled. Best fit for a hungry walk-in, pre-game bite, or a late-night slice rather than a sit-down dinner. Value feels strong thanks to generous portions and fair slice pricing for the area. Families will find it easy to feed kids here: plain cheese slices, pepperoni, fries, and simple pastas are straightforward wins. There is no kids menu, but the familiar options and speed help. Seating is tight, so plan for quick eats or takeaway during rushes.
